Default which dealer best for service?

Many answers will be none, but besides that...

Thinking of getting an oil/filter change and possibly a valve adjustment before my '06 goes into hibernation.

Oil is about 4000 miles/4 years old, car has 36xxx miles.

Which local dealer is recommended?

Also, should I worry about valve adjustment and what is the cost at dealer

Oil change - any dealer should be fine provided they use the s2000 specific oil filter. I usually carry my own Mobil 1 10W-30.

Valve adjustment you’ll have to leave overnight.

Have it done at Quantum or if you’re up to it reach out to Billman and go see him on Long Island. Billman will do your valve adjustment without you having to leave the car overnight
